The Breakdown 13

  • Ukraine has intensified its military efforts by launching drone attacks on Russian oil facilities, particularly targeting the key Black Sea port of Novorossiysk, disrupting supply lines and causing a spike in oil prices.
  • The use of advanced weaponry, including long-range "Flamingo" missiles, marks a significant escalation in Ukraine's strategy to hit Russian energy resources amid the ongoing conflict.
  • On the same day, the capital city of Kyiv faced a barrage of strikes from Russian forces, igniting widespread fires and inflicting damage across multiple districts, including critical infrastructure and residential areas.
  • Civilians and emergency responders suffered injuries as air defenses struggled against the massive assault, highlighting the pervasive dangers faced by the population during these relentless attacks.
  • The ongoing back-and-forth violence has drawn international concern, elevating geopolitical tensions and emphasizing the fragile state of security in the region.
  • This latest chapter in the Ukraine-Russia conflict not only underscores the volatility of the situation but also reflects the profound impact on global energy markets and local civilian lives.

What are the implications of the Kyiv attacks?

The attacks on Kyiv signify an escalation in the conflict, highlighting Russia's willingness to intensify its military operations against Ukraine. This not only raises concerns about civilian safety but also affects international relations, prompting potential responses from NATO and other countries. The attacks can also lead to increased sanctions against Russia and greater military support for Ukraine from Western nations.

What is the significance of Novorossiysk port?

Novorossiysk is a key Russian port on the Black Sea, crucial for oil exports. It serves as a major hub for transporting Russian crude oil, making it strategically important for the country's economy. Attacks on this port disrupt supply chains and can lead to fluctuations in global oil prices, affecting energy markets worldwide.

How do oil prices react to geopolitical tensions?

Oil prices typically rise during geopolitical tensions due to supply fears. Conflicts that threaten oil production or transport routes lead to market uncertainties, prompting traders to bid up prices. The recent attacks on oil facilities in Russia have caused prices to spike, reflecting concerns over potential supply disruptions and the overall impact on global energy security.

What historical context shapes Ukraine-Russia relations?

Ukraine-Russia relations are deeply influenced by historical ties dating back to the Soviet Union. Post-Soviet independence in 1991 led to tensions over territorial integrity and national identity. The annexation of Crimea in 2014 marked a significant turning point, leading to ongoing conflict in Eastern Ukraine and shaping current hostilities, with both sides entrenched in their positions.
